Subject: Key rotation following currency-rounding fix

Team — ahead of Thursday's sync: the fix for the half-cent rounding drift in Ledgerline's conversion path required redeploying the internal Ratesmith service, and we rotated its key as part of that release. Please verify any consumer you own reconciles to the corrected rates before Friday's close. For reference during validation, the current Ratesmith key appears below.

app token of tagef-tafog = qvz3-7n0

**Vendor note: Inkmill markdown pipeline**

Rendering for Parchway docs is outsourced to Inkmill under an annual contract, renewing each March. They handle sanitization and PDF export; we own the upload queue. SLA: 4-hour response on rendering failures. Escalate only after two failed retries. Their support desk is reachable at the address below.

billing contact of hahaf-baguf = zorael.tammir.jorius@sivrelhq.internal

Nightly backfills run through Quillrun, our internal scheduler. Jobs are defined in YAML under /backfills and trigger at 02:00 UTC. Retries: 3, exponential backoff. Check the Quillrun dashboard before adding new jobs to avoid window overlap. To submit or cancel jobs from the CLI, authenticate with the team's Quillrun service key, shown below.

API key for yahig-tadup: kto7_ubizbYm

Minutes — Management Meeting, Orvano Retail Group

Attendees: R. Temes (chair), L. Okafor, D. Virell. Topic: pricing review of the Cascata homeware line. It was agreed that list prices rise 6% from next quarter, with branch managers retaining discretion on bundle discounts up to 10%. Margins on the entry tier were judged unsustainable and will be reassessed monthly. Before circulating to staff, managers should note the strategic context recorded below.

internal memo for kawip-hadug: Headcount on the Wenwyn team goes from 7 to 140 by the end of January. Gross margin on Wenwyn came in at 20 percent against a plan of 15 percent.